At a moment of tension for the UK-US “special relationship”, will King Charles’ meeting with President Donald Trump help smooth relations with Prime Minister Keir Starmer?

Last week, President Trump told BBC North America Editor Sarah Smith that the King could “absolutely” help repair relations, but this follows numerous attacks from the US president towards Starmer over his position on the US-Israel war with Iran.

BBC’s Jo Crawford spoke to North America Editor Sarah Smith to examine the political backdrop to the King’s visit to the US and with Royal Correspondent Sarah Campbell, to explore Trump’s fascination with the British Royal Family.
